Output 66d292517a20755b1ad38196adc33ebdc34a2d2557a6a7fbde2efca21f9a44e5:0

value
1935299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5044322ac02a92ec3d3daa63bafbd017d3d09ad1 OP_EQUAL
address
391RgEEFDvrEzKCqJ6aM7FiXDBZxpvmMpq
transaction
66d292517a20755b1ad38196adc33ebdc34a2d2557a6a7fbde2efca21f9a44e5
spent
true